How to create the Best Backlinks

Backlinks can be good and evil, then how could you find the difference between good and bad links? It’s easy to find a good link. If you also want to create a good link, you must know about it. Let’s look at the factors of good and bad links, i.e., the foremost vital factor is the link’s relevance. The link must be appropriate to the site. For example- if your website is about clothing, you must ensure the links that fit in with your content or not. The link must be sourced from a high-quality site or page. If it’s full of useless links and low-quality material, these kinds of links won’t help you build your business. The link from high authority sites must help develop traffic and high ranking. Good-quality backlinks benefit the brand. It also creates brand awareness among customers.

It is crucial to choose good backlinks because choosing the bad backlinks will result in a penalty by Google. First, however, you need to analyze your backlink profile to make sure you don’t have links to bad sites. You can Backlink analyze with SEMrush or Ubersuggest to disavow toxic backlinks from your website.

First, you need to learn more about how to get quality backlinks. There are five tested ways to find good quality backlinks. First, you can use a link checker tool like Ahrefs to find pages that mention your company or brand on their page and then review them. Next, you can contact the blog page and gently request that the broken link be replaced with yours. Third, you can provide helpful information or content to draw customers to your website. Fourth, you can look for websites that allow your field. Finally, you can offer audiovisual infographics or screenshots to other bloggers in your niche.

Links from sites with a high domain authority are essential for skyrocketing your search engine ranks. You can check the domain authority through Moz Link Explorer and Link Explorer. Links from high authority sites with long-form content have more value than short content because long-form content gives deeper information about topics. The user can easily find whatever information they’re looking for. According to a study conducted by SERPIQ, top-ranked pages of Google had an average of 2,450 words.
